1990 Eagle Talon review from North America
"Premium value for the dollars invested"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
Famous timing belt, fortunately no piston damage, just a head rebuild.
Plug wires caused poor running, replaced then OK.
Interior parts just fall off. Visor, rear view mirror, hatch cover supports, roof liner.
Door handle mechanism broke in cold Canuk weather.
Rides like a stone boat in winter.
Dealer tint peeling real bad, have to take it out.
Rear hatch gas struts need replacing.
Starting to consume oil at 280k.
General comments?
Very quick, good looker for 12 year old machine. Tires glue to road, excellent handling and steering. Will likely hanger it and rebuilt engine over winter.
Would love it more if it had a turbo.
